请帮助PHP语法

请帮助PHP语法,php,html,Php,Html,这是我的表格 <form id="place-bid" action="placebid.php?placeBidProductId='.$row['product_id'].'" method="post" > Your Bid:<br> <input type="text" placeholder="$$$" name="money"> <input type="Submit" cla

这是我的表格

<form id="place-bid" action="placebid.php?placeBidProductId='.$row['product_id'].'" method="post" >
                        Your Bid:<br>
    <input type="text"  placeholder="$$$" name="money">
    <input type="Submit" class="button_bid" name="submit" value="Place Bid">
    <input type=hidden id='rowid' value=".row['product_id']." name='row_id'>
</form>
这是我的placebid.php

<?php
   // $product_id=$_GET['placeBidProductId'];
   $product_id=$_POST['row_id'];
   echo " Id Produs : ".$product_id;
?>

我的问题是:我无法从$row['product\U id']获取值,它将只回显字符串$row['product\U id']。$product\U id

将print\u r$\u POST用于表单操作页面(即placebid.php)上的所有表单POST值。它将以形式向你展示所有的价值。然后相应地创建业务逻辑。

我猜在输出表单之前,您正在对数据库进行某种查询。如果是这种情况,那么您可能需要更改这一行

<input type=hidden id='rowid' value=".row['product_id']." name='row_id'>


谢谢你的回复,但是有点混乱。我在我的placebid.php中写了这篇打印文章,当我按下表单的按钮时,它会显示如下内容:数组[money]=>[submit]=>placebid[row\u id]=>.row['product\u id']。行['product_id']有一个特定的值,即整数,因此,''我无法获得正确的值。。我得到的只是那根绳子。。我不知道如何解释自己;在浏览器上查看人类可读的数据。在表单提交之前,还要在文本输入字段中输入一些值。我希望它能帮上忙。你希望它能回来吗?您已将表单设置为该精确值。如果您试图使用数据库中的查询结果生成表单,则需要向我们显示更多代码。从目前的情况看,你所得到的正是你在你的表格中所提供的。我知道我应该向你展示更多,但这听起来像是一个故事。我和xampp一起工作。我有一个数据库和一些表。其中一个名为productsint product_id、varchar product_name、product_description、category_id FK to Categories table、seller_id,还有一个名为img的列,其类型为BLOB;我制作了一个HTML文件,显示特定类别的所有产品。每个产品都有一个竞价表单,因为它是一个在线拍卖应用程序,当按下“竞价”按钮时,我想在一个名为“竞价”的表格中插入产品id。我将在这里发布我的所有代码。你已经有了一个你说有效的答案,因此不需要发布更多信息。这行代码使它有效。谢谢。。你真的帮了我
<input type=hidden id='rowid' value="<?php echo row['product_id'];>" name='row_id'>